Peptide NamePhenylalanine–dehydrophenylalanine (FΔF)
Peptide sequenceFΔPhe
N-Terminal ModificationFree
C-Terminal ModificationFree
Non-Terminal ModificationΔPhe=Dehydrophenylalanine
Length2
Peptide/ConjuagatePeptide
TechniqueTEM (Transmission Electron Microscopy), DLS (Dynamic light - scattering)
SolventMethanol and water (50:50; v/v).
MethodStock solutions were prepared by dissolving 2 mg of peptide in 50 μL of methanol, solution is sonicated to dissolve. Assembly was initiated by addition of 1 mL of aqueous methanol (50% v/v) to the stock. Samples were incubated for 24 hours.
Conc2mg/ml
TemperatureRoom temperature
Incubation Time24 hours
Year2012
Self assemblyNo
Type of Self assemblyNo Nanoparticle formation

Peptide NamePhe-Δphe (Phenylalanine -dehydrophenylalanine)
Peptide sequenceFΔPhe
N-Terminal ModificationFree
C-Terminal ModificationFree
Non-Terminal ModificationΔPhe=Dehydrophenylalanine
Length2
Peptide/ConjuagatePeptide
Conjugate partnerNone
TechniqueTEM (Transmission Electron Microscopy) and DLS (Dynamic Light scattering)
SolventHFIP (1,1,1,3,3,3-hexafluoro-2-Isopropanol) + 0.8M Sodium acetate
MethodA 50 mg/mL HFIP solution of Phe-Δphe added to 0.8 M sodium acetate buffer to get a final concentration between 0.2-1% w/v at pH 7. The mixture was then boiled in a boiling water bath for 15 min or in a microwave oven for 3 min and cooled back to room temperature to form gel.
Conc0.2-1% w/v
Temperature7
TemperatureRoom temperature
Year2008
Self assemblyYes
Type of Self assemblyHydrogel (consists of fibers)

Peptide NamePhe-Δphe (Phenylalanine -dehydrophenylalanine)
Peptide sequenceFΔPhe
N-Terminal ModificationFree
C-Terminal ModificationFree
Non-Terminal ModificationΔPhe=Dehydrophenylalanine
Length2
Peptide/ConjuagatePeptide
Conjugate partnerNone
TechniqueTEM (Transmission Electron Microscopy) and AFM (Atomic Force Microscopy)
SolventHFIP (1,1,1,3,3,3-hexafluoro-2-Isopropanol) + 0.8M Sodium acetate buffer
MethodPeptide in HFIP (50 mg/mL) was added to sodium acetate buffer (0.8 M, pH 7) to get final peptide concentrations between 0.2 and 1% w/v. Mixtures were heated in boiling water bath for 15 min and cooled to room temperature to get hydrogels.
Conc0.2 - 1% w/v
Temperature7
TemperatureRoom temperature
Year2010
Self assemblyYes
Type of Self assemblyHydrogel (consists of fibers)
